    Amazing!!! This was our first time here but it was the best indoor play place (not counting…read moremuseums) that I've been to in NC! I've definitely been to a few that I thought were overpriced for what you get. I highly recommend this place. It's super affordable ($10 per child to start and cheaper when you are paying for more than one kid, better value overall to get a monthly membership which I believe starts at $34 a month). It pays for itself if you just come here 3x a month or more. They've also got little snacks for sale up at the front desk and you can purchase socks for $1 (they've got music notes on them haha). We arrived early around 9:20am when the inflatable bounce houses were still getting filled but the doors were open and the person at the front desk said it was unexpectedly busy this morning! The place gets pretty busy but emptied out around 11:30 when I assume most people left to go get lunch/put kids down for nap time. Tons of cute little snack tables and chairs for the smaller kiddos and bigger ones for waiting parents/grandparents/caretakers etc. Lots of sanitizer on every counter. They also had Kleenex boxes out (they know their audience) and Clorox wipes at the front desk. There's 2 big bounce houses (a blue one and a red one). The red one is more for jumping and running around in circles and the blue one has a rainbow "floor" interior that is super fun to run across. There are also 2 karaoke rooms with an expansive music selection, colorful overhead lights, and microphones which you ask for from the front desk. They've got the giant piano on the floor like the one from the movie 'Big'. They've got music classes which I believe take place in the back near the restrooms. Love the giant guitar slide and it makes guitar sounds when you slide down. I went down the slide as well and it goes super quick!! I was definitely more scared going down than climbing up haha. Oh and they provide a shelf of croc sandals to wear if you need to rescue your frightened child (I made use of them). I could really go on forever about how amazing this place is. Absolutely exceeded expectations. Incredible experience and place and definitely will be returning!!

    I took my almost two year old here, with my younger babe in tow, for the first time today and they…read moreabsolutely loved it. The play area is open and spaced out with a nice variety of musical things to play with. Before coming, I really was curious if there'd be enough to keep the little one interested. Big or little, the kids will be interested! By musical things, think less handheld instruments and more installments for lack of a better word, such as the interactive world map where touching the musical note plays music of that geographic location. The percussion pots and pans and bells room was a big hit. My toddler wasn't ready for the big guitar slide, with climbing handholds and bars, but was able to enjoy everything else, including the small slide. I found it easy to carry my infant around and plop him on the floor from time to time with little worry. Some bigger kids run around but there are many side areas that are safer for the wee babes. There's music playing in the background and of course sounds coming from the many installments, and children shrieking. But overall, I didn't find the sound to be too loud or nauseating like it can be in some restaurants and such. There's plenty of space to enjoy snacks outside of the play area and clean bathrooms. The staff I checked in with were quite friendly. Oh and I really thought the price per child to be reasonable compared to most other indoor museums and play places. We will definitely be back!
